Elephant Stable

A beautiful period bungalow overlooking Kandy, once home to Sir Cuda Ratwatte, the first Ceylonese nobleman to be knighted by the British. The only boutique hotel to be located so close to Kandy centre (15mins). Lovingly restored with a combination of Colonial furniture and chic interiors to provide an interesting yet luxurious experience. The friendly hosts combine professionally trained staff with local villagers. Whilst English can occasionally be a barrier for some, their smiles are more than welcoming. Elephant Stables welcomes families and has ample space and large gardens for the full privacy of all guests. Elephants were a regular sight in the late 1800’s and the manager can arrange for children to get close and play in the gardens with Menika, a young female elephant with a docile temperament. The tradiuonal Redaing Room showcases a magnificent collection of Henduwas (elephant training poles) Adults may be more impressed by the two colonial vehicles that are always parked out front, ready to whisk clients away on day excursions. Choose between and Austin a55, Austin a12, Mini Moke convertible and a Ford Prefect! The gardens are well tendered and a proud man he should be. Perfect lawns, ornamental ponds and a pool and outdoor bathing, sitting area, where drinks can be served all day. Sip cocktails under the Araliya tree and look onto Mahaweli river valley and knuckles mountain range on the horizon. The infinity pool is surrounded by sun loungers, fresh towels and a waiter. The magic on a hot day is to sprinkle on iced water from personal clay pots - service going the extra mile and much appreciated! The colonial living room is very spacious with modern sofas and historic artefacts. A 55” TV screen is the perfect movie house for the Owner’s collection of 100 favorite DVD’s, complete with classics shot in Ceylon of yesteryear. One of Sri Lanka’s finest!

Dining

Indika, the head chef is an enthusiastic and experienced chef who prepares 2 set menus each day. However he is always happy to accommodate personal requests and dietary needs. Sadly the Room rates are on B&B basis only so costs can add up but if you are out in the day you may not want to take advantage of all of Chef’s delights. Breakfast is a full English, Continental or traditional Sri Lankan affair. Indika’s coconut pancakes are a personal favourite. Lunch is a la carte and can range from sandwiches, salads, pasta to full dinner should you wish. A 3 course dinner menu is available each evening and always includes a Sri Lankan Curry. Chilli strength can always be tempered for children. Set menus of Asian fusion or Western can be provided, as can Vegetarian options. With advance notice, head chef can also provide a special a la carte menu for a group banquet. Desserts can be quite sweet but are a Sri Lankan speciality, with Jaggery and Kithul honey very often the base ingredient. Fresh fruit can be a simpler option. Afternoon tea is served with fresh cakes and sandwiches from 3-6pm daily by the Mango Trees. You will here the Japanese Karp jumping in the nearby pond. Dining can be enjoyed in 5 locations: the Green dining room - Sir Ratwatte’s traditional breakfast room, the Bar area- ideal for family dining. Or opt for alfresco dining and admire the stars and fruit bats swoop majestically for fruit : the verandah, Garden dining around the candlelit poolside, and in the front garden before the mountain views. The juice bar will be popular with the kids as Nihal combines scrumptious fruits and mocktails for the exhausted traveller. Notch up a note in the evening for some of Nihals amazing cocktail creations.
